City Uprising NYC: The Results are In

Many of you have been asking about the results of our work last week during City Uprising. This report will focus on the numbers. In the near future we will publish a report that deals with the testimonies from the week. But here are the hard numbers:

Art Projects:
500 New Yorkers directly engaged art projects (creating art, engaging in conversation, etc).
Over 150 photos created in the "Purity" Project
Art Exhibit with over 50 people in attendance

Community Projects:

Worked with 6 community organizations (schools, clinics, etc).
12 work projects
67 gallons of paint used
9500 square feet of interior wall space painted
1 wall built at Community Health Clinic
Folded Clothes/ Organized Thrift Store for Homeless Shelter and Health Clinic

HIV Testing:

Day 1:
14 Testing Sites
370 Individuals Tested

Day 2:
8 Testing Sites
256 Individuals Tested

Day Three:
18 Testing Sites
1221 Individuals Tested (our goal was 1000)

Totals:
40 Testing Sites
1847 Individuals Tested
Average of 46 Individuals Tested Per Site!
